Do I still need a physical card if I have an electronic medical card?

With the electronic medical card, there is no need for a physical card.

With the continuous development of technology, electronic medical cards have become an important part of modern medical services. Compared with traditional physical medical cards, electronic medical cards are more convenient, safer and more environmentally friendly. Therefore, with electronic medical cards, people no longer need physical cards.

The use of electronic medical cards greatly facilitates patients. Patients can check their health information, make appointments, and pay bills anytime and anywhere through mobile phones, computers and other electronic devices. In addition, electronic medical cards can also provide medical services across hospitals and regions, allowing patients to easily switch between different hospitals, avoiding the inconvenience caused by changing cards.

Electronic medical cards have high security. Traditional physical medical cards are easily lost and damaged. Once lost, patients' personal information and health data may be leaked. The electronic medical card uses advanced encryption technology to effectively protect patient privacy and information security. At the same time, the electronic medical card can also implement real-name management to ensure that each patient’s identity information is accurate.

Electronic medical cards are beneficial to the environment. Traditional physical medical cards require a lot of paper and plastic to produce, which not only consumes resources but also generates a lot of waste. The electronic medical card uses digital technology to achieve paperless office and reduce the impact on the environment.

In summary, with electronic medical cards, people no longer need physical cards. Electronic medical cards not only facilitate patients and improve the efficiency of medical services, but also ensure patient information security and are beneficial to the environment. Therefore, promoting the use of electronic medical cards is a general trend and an inevitable trend in the development of medical services.
